What is the number of unit cells present in a cubic pack crystal lattice having 4 atoms per unit cell and weighing 0.60 ~g (molar mass .60 ~g ~mol ⁻¹ ) ?

Options

  1. A1 10²¹
  2. B1.5 10²¹
  3. C3.0 10²¹
  4. D6.0 10²¹

Correct answer

B. 1.5 10²¹

Step-by-step solution

Number of moles = 0.6 ~g 60 ~g ~mol ⁻¹ =0.01 ~mol Total number of atoms =0.01 6.022 10²³ Number of atoms per unit cell =4 (Given) Number of unit cells present in the given cubic crystal lattice aligned & = 0.01 6.022 10²³ 4 & =1.5 10²¹ unit cells aligned
